How to Focus DBPOWER Projector for the Perfect Home Movie Experience

A DBPOWER projector is a great device to have for a home movie experience. However, when it comes to getting the perfect picture, a lot relies on how you focus it. In this article, we will give you a step-by-step guide on how to focus your DBPOWER projector to get the perfect picture quality for your movie.

Step 1: Set up your projector

The first step in focusing your DBPOWER projector is to set it up. This involves connecting your projector to a power source and a video source such as a laptop or a DVD player. Once you have your projector connected to your video source, turn on the projector and allow it to warm up for a few minutes.

Step 2: Adjust the distance

The next step in focusing your DBPOWER projector is to adjust the distance between the projector and the screen. The distance depends on the size of the picture you want to create. A rule of thumb is that for every foot of screen width, the projector should be placed one to one and a half feet away from the screen. Therefore, if you have a 60-inch screen, then your projector should be placed between 5 and 7.5 feet away from the screen.

Step 3: Adjust the focus ring

Once you have set up the projector and adjusted the distance, you can now focus the image. To do this, locate the focus ring on your DBPOWER projector. The focus ring is usually located near the projector lens and can be turned to adjust the focus of the image. Turn the focus ring until the image appears sharp and clear.

Step 4: Check the Keystone Correction

Keystone correction is an adjustment that allows the projector to correct for the distortion of the image that occurs when a projector is not placed at a perfect right angle to the screen. Most projectors, including DBPOWER projectors, have keystone correction options that you can adjust. Use the remote control to adjust the keystone correction until the image appears square and symmetrical.

Step 5: Make final adjustments

Once you have adjusted the focus ring and keystone correction, take a step back and look at the image. If anything looks out of place, fine-tune the adjustments until you are satisfied with the image quality. Your DBPOWER projector should now be perfectly focused and ready for your movie.

How to Focus DBPOWER Projector for Optimal Image Quality

DBPOWER projectors are becoming increasingly popular due to their affordability and high image quality. However, users often struggle with getting the best image quality from their projector due to poor focus. To help you get the best out of your DBPOWER projector, we have created a guide on how to focus DBPOWER projector for optimal image quality.

Adjusting the Keystone Correction

Keystone Correction is a function that enables you to correct image distortion resulting from the projection angle. Keystone correction can be found on your DBPOWER projector’s remote control. Adjusting the keystone correction will also help to improve the focus of your image. First, adjust the projector angle to your desired projection size. Then, press the keystone correction button and adjust the horizontal and vertical keystone until the image is perfectly rectangular.

Using the Focus Ring

Your DBPOWER projector comes with a focus ring located on the lens. To adjust the focus, turn the focus ring until the image is sharp and clear. This step is crucial in getting optimal image quality from your DBPOWER projector. If you find that the image is still blurry, check if the lens is clean and free from any dust or fingerprints.

Setting the Right Distance

The distance between your DBPOWER projector and the projection surface plays a significant role in image quality. To get the best image quality, ensure that the projector is placed at the recommended distance listed in the user manual. If the distance is too far or too close, the image will be unfocused and distorted.

Using a Tripod

Another way to improve the focus of your DBPOWER projector is to use a tripod. A tripod ensures that the projector is stable and at the correct height, which helps to get a sharper and clearer image. If you don’t have a tripod, you can also use a flat and sturdy surface to place your projector.

Title: Do Movie Projectors Really Work? The Science Behind the Magic of Cinema

Movie projectors have been a staple in cinema history, providing the world with entertainment for over a century. From the early days of silent films to the modern-day blockbuster, movie projectors have been the backbone of the movie industry. But how do they actually work? In this article, well explore the science behind the magic of cinema and answer the question, do movie projectors really work?

Movie projectors work by projecting light through a series of lenses and onto a screen. The light source in a projector can be either a traditional bulb or a more modern LED light. The light is then focused through a reflecting mirror and onto a spinning color wheel, which adds color to the image being projected.

Once the color is added, the light is focused again through a series of lenses and onto the screen. The quality of the projected image depends on the quality of the projectors lenses, as well as the resolution of the film being projected.

The process of projecting an image onto a screen may seem simple, but the science behind it is complex. It involves the principles of light and optics, including reflection, refraction, and diffraction. The lenses used in a projector are carefully designed to manipulate the light waves and create a focused image.

In addition to the technical aspects of the projector, the movie itself plays a significant role in how the projectors work. The film used in a projector is composed of a series of images that are displayed in succession at a rapid rate. This creates the illusion of motion and allows the audience to perceive a continuous image.

One of the key components of modern movie projectors is their ability to project images in high definition. This requires the use of digital projectors, which are designed to project digital images rather than traditional film. These projectors use a digital light processing (DLP) chip to create the image and have revolutionized the film industry by providing incredibly realistic images on the big screen.
